Street dancers as young as three showed off their best moves to win a clutch of awards in their first competition.

A group from Epic Dance, which has classes in Burnham and Cold Norton, attended the Street Dance International contest in Kent last weekend.

They performed in front of more than 800 people.

Teacher Carlie Boler said: “This was the first time these children have even been to a competition, so it was very overwhelming and they were so nervous.

“But I am so proud of their achievements and am looking forward to working hard to get prepared for the next one.”
